Notes • When storing the battery long-term, use up any remaining charge, then remove the battery and store it in a cool place. In addition, fully charge the battery and use up the entire charge at least once a year, before returning the battery to storage. • Like other rechargeable batteries, the supplied lithium-ion battery gradually loses its ability to charge with repeated use. When battery life decreases significantly, it is time to buy a new battery. The battery can be charged about 300 times before it needs replacement. • Depending on the type of battery, the battery charge may run out and cause the power to shut off before the r indicator appears. Carrying and Positioning the Monitor Using the Monitor Handle (LF-X1 Only) Pull out and use the handle on top when carrying the monitor. Pull Adjusting the Monitor Stand ◆For the LF-X1 Use the monitor stand to adjust the screen angle, as shown. The stand has a range of 120 degrees. Under normal lighting conditions. ◆For the LF-X5 Make the monitor upright using the stand on the bottom. 28
